Al Ain’s 5,000-Year History Carved Into a Dh800,000 Knife

A single hand forged knife worth more than Dh800,000 is set to showcase Al Ain’s five millennia old history at this year’s Abu Dhabi International Hunting And Equestrian Exhibition.

The 100 kilogrammes plus creation, which took more than 18 months to make, will be Tamreen General Trading’s 2026 flagship display as it traces the region’s history from the Stone Age through to the Bronze and Iron ages, and right up to the present day.

But instead of simply depicting the falaj, the subterranean irrigation system which underpins the Al Ain oases, the company decided to capture the essence of the entire region’s archaeological heritage in a single creation, said general manager Mohammed Al Amiri.

Researchers and craftsmen visited a number of heritage sites and museums in the emirate to get design inspiration, including ancient engraved seals, part of which have been recreated in the knives’ Damascus-steel blades.

The knife’s silhouette mirrors the falaj system itself: a sculpted form evokes mountains and water sources, with channels running toward the ‘sharia’ outlet before reaching the oasis, farms and gardens the falaj once sustained.

A recessed section stands in for stored water, while the surrounding contours echo Al Ain’s dunes and mountain terrain. Materials were chosen to mark different eras — stone for the Stone Age, copper for the Bronze Age, and iron alongside Damascus steel for later periods — including a stone blade mounted in copper.

Al Amiri noted that assembling the multi-metal Damascus blade was the most technically demanding stage, requiring several forged pieces to be combined into a single pattern.

Despite the intricate craftsmanship, he emphasised the knife remains fully functional rather than ornamental.

Tamreen has released a themed historical knife annually since 2022, previous editions honouring falconry, Fujairah’s Bronze Age heritage and the UAE’s desert landscape.

The firm, exhibiting at the Abu Dhabi show since 2007, is also presenting over 2,000 knife models and three new designs this year.
